You will need the following:
1 yellow cake mix
2/3 cup oil
8 oz. sour cream
4 eggs
1 tsp. cinnamon
1 cup brown sugar
Mix together the cake mix, oil, sour cream, and eggs. Blend well and pour 1/2 of the mixture into a greased 9x13" pan. Then mix together the brown sugar and cinnamon. Pour the sugar mixture over the batter. Top this with the remaining batter.
Bake at 350 degrees for 35-40 minutes. While the cake is still warm punch holes in the cake with a fork. Mix together the glaze and pour over the cake.
Glaze:
2 1/2 cups powdered sugar
1/2 cup milk
1 tsp. vanilla
Allow the cake to cool before you cut it. I did not do this before this picture was taken.
